Seagate Technology Sees AI Storage Demand Fueling HAMR Growth and Margin Gains
AI infrastructure is boosting storage demand across hyperscalers, enterprises and on-premises data centers, with applications such as video AI, robotics and autonomous driving driving long-term data growth.
Seagate is expanding capacity primarily through higher-capacity drives and its HAMR technology . The company is selling 30TB HAMR drives broadly, 40TB drives to two major hyperscalers, expects a 50TB product around late 2027, and projects HAMR will represent 80%–90% of data-center volume within a few years.
Strong orders, pricing and supply discipline are supporting continued revenue and margin gains; Seagate reported incremental gross margins above 70% recently and plans to prioritize debt reduction before increasing share repurchases and potentially dividends.
Seagate Technology NASDAQ: STX CFO Gianluca Romano said demand for mass storage is being supported by the early stages of artificial intelligence infrastructure investment, with growth extending from large public-cloud customers to enterprise original equipment manufacturers and on-premises data centers.
Speaking at the Goldman Sachs Communacopia + Technology Conference, Romano said customer capital-expenditure trends indicate that AI investment remains in an early phase. He pointed to expanding data requirements from video AI, robotics, autonomous driving and AI-enabled quality-control applications as drivers of long-term storage demand.
“Everything is based on data,” Romano said. “When you have valuable data, the cost of storage is minimal comparing to recompute that data.”
Romano said Seagate’s strategy centers on increasing exabyte shipments through higher-capacity drives rather than significantly raising unit output. He said the hard-drive industry has maintained capital-expenditure and capacity discipline for the past two to three years, helping preserve a balance between supply and demand.
The company has previously discussed a mid-20% compound annual growth rate in exabytes over a three- to four-year period. Romano said investors should also consider absolute exabyte growth, rather than focusing solely on percentage growth as the company’s shipment base expands. He said a transition from a 30-terabyte drive to a 40-terabyte drive can add 33% more capacity per unit.
Seagate’s technology and pricing strategy over the past three years have helped it nearly triple gross margin, according to Romano, while storage represents only a low- to mid-single-digit percentage of customers’ capital expenditures.
Romano added that purchase orders currently in place for Seagate’s fiscal year support the company’s expectation for revenue and margin improvement in every quarter of the year.
Romano highlighted Seagate’s heat-assisted magnetic recording, or HAMR, technology as a key element of its capacity expansion. He said Seagate is selling 30-terabyte HAMR drives to all major hyperscale customers and is selling 40-terabyte drives to its two largest hyperscale customers while qualifying the product with additional customers in the United States and Asia.
The company expects its 50-terabyte product to arrive around the end of calendar 2027, Romano said. He reiterated that Seagate expects HAMR to reach volume crossover by December and projected that HAMR could account for 80% to 90% of Seagate’s data-center volume within a couple of years.
